Genuine Staria Lounge DRL LED Installation Process
This upgrade involves fitting the genuine Staria Lounge DRL LED components onto a Staria Cargo Tourer. This is a legal modification that will pass vehicle inspections. The process entails carefully removing the existing stock parts and replacing them with the Lounge model's bar-shaped LED DRLs.
- Carefully remove the original black plastic covers from the front bumper where the DRLs are intended to be installed.
- Remove the existing components, ensuring they are stored safely.
- Install the new genuine Staria Lounge LED DRL units, which typically come in three sections.
- Connect the wiring harness to the new LED units.
- Test the DRLs to ensure they function correctly with the vehicle's lighting system (e.g., dimming with headlights).

Staria Daytime Running Light Upgrade Details
Pricing: The cost for replacing the Staria Cargo Tourer's DRLs with genuine Staria Lounge LED units typically ranges from ₩300,000 to ₩500,000, including parts and labor. Prices may vary based on parts availability and the specific workshop. It's advisable to get a precise quote from your chosen installer.
Installation Time: This DRL upgrade is a relatively straightforward procedure, usually completed within 1 to 2 hours.
Frequently Asked Questions
Q. How much does an LED lighting upgrade cost for a Hyundai Staria?
In Korea, upgrading to genuine Staria Lounge LED Daytime Running Lights typically costs between ₩300,000 and ₩500,000, including parts and labor. In the US, similar genuine part upgrades can range from $250 to $400, depending on the specific components and installation costs.
Q. How long do aftermarket LED headlights last on a Hyundai Staria?
Genuine LED DRL units, like those installed on the Staria Lounge, are designed for longevity and can last for many years, often exceeding 100,000 hours of use. To maximize their lifespan, ensure they are properly sealed to prevent moisture ingress and avoid excessive voltage fluctuations.
Q. Is an LED lighting upgrade worth it for a Hyundai Staria?
An LED lighting upgrade is highly recommended for Staria owners seeking to improve both safety and aesthetics, especially for models lacking integrated DRLs. The enhanced visibility and premium appearance justify the investment for many owners.
Q. How is an LED lighting upgrade installed on a Hyundai Staria?
Installation involves carefully removing the stock front bumper covers, disconnecting any existing wiring, and then fitting the new genuine LED DRL modules. The wiring harness is connected to the new units, and the components are secured in place before testing their functionality.
Q. What is the difference between HID and LED headlights for a Hyundai Staria?
LEDs offer instant illumination, longer lifespan, and greater energy efficiency compared to HIDs, which require a warm-up period and can be more prone to failure. For most modern applications, LEDs provide superior performance and reliability for headlight and DRL upgrades.
